## Summary

West Berkshire Council is initiating a public procurement process to install and maintain audio-visual RTPI screens at various bus stops and shelters in the district. This procurement is currently in the planning stage, with the process tagged under "planning" as of 17th December 2025. Located in Newbury, England, West Berkshire Council seeks to enhance public-service transport infrastructure within the UK South East region (UKJ11), categorised under services. Potential vendors have an opportunity to engage in a market survey due by 12th January 2026, and the formal tender communication might be available from 2nd February 2026. The process is guided by UKPGA legal standards, aiming to secure the services of contractors beginning 15th April 2026, with the contract potentially extending until April 2028.

This tender opens up opportunities for small to medium enterprises (SMEs) and voluntary community and social enterprises (VCSEs) to compete, with both being explicitly deemed suitable for this project.
